Introducing Tianmen Mountain Cableway

The Zhangjiajie Tianmen Mountain Cableway begins at the City Garden in downtown Zhangjiajie and reaches the pristine Hanging Gardens atop Tianmen Mountain, one of the "Four Wonders" of the Tianmen Mountain Scenic Area. It's the world's longest sightseeing passenger cableway, with an inclined length of 7,455 meters and a 1,277-meter elevation difference between the upper and lower stations. A one-way trip takes approximately 28 minutes.

Most Popular FAQs for Tianmen Mountain Cableway

What is the history and significance of this attraction/city?

Tianmen Mountain is one of the most famous natural landmarks in Zhangjiajie, Hunan. Known for its sheer cliffs, lush greenery, and Tianmen Cave, the mountain has become a symbol of the area's stunning natural beauty. The Tianmen Mountain Cableway, the world's longest cable car ride, offers visitors a chance to view the spectacular landscape from above.

Where is it located and how do I get there (metro, bus, taxi, walking)?

Tianmen Mountain is located about 8 kilometers from Zhangjiajie city center. The Tianmen Mountain Cableway station can be reached by taxi or bus from the city. The cable car takes you directly to the summit, providing spectacular views along the way.

What are the must-see highlights or main areas inside?

Must-see highlights include the Tianmen Cave, the Glass Walkway, and the panoramic views from the cable car ride. The mountain also offers scenic hiking paths and the famous 99-bend mountain road.
